跳转到帖子

伪静态能提高SEO效果,因为它将动态URL转化为简洁的静态URL,便于搜索引擎抓取和索引。静态URL更易包含关键词,提高页面的可读性和用户体验,有助于提升排名。此外,伪静态减少了重复内容问题,提升加载速度,增加爬虫抓取效率,从而优化SEO表现。

IPS Invision Community由于是国外的程序,且是全球最贵的社区套件程序,在大陆市场还未普及,下面发一下教程,本站的程序就是使用的IPS套件。

宝塔面板 -> 单击 你的论坛.com -> 伪静态 -> 0.当前

将以下的伪静态,复制并黏贴 -> 保存

以下是Nginx伪静态规则:

location / {
        try_files  $uri $uri/ /index.php;
  }
location ~^(/page/).*(.php)$ {
    try_files  $uri $uri/ /index.php;
}

location /api/ {
  if (!-e $request_filename){
    rewrite ^/api/(.*)$ /api/index.php;
  }
}

Apache伪静态规则:

<IfModule mod_rewrite.c>
Options -MultiViews
RewriteEngine On
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teRule \.(js|css|jpeg|jpg|gif|png|ico|map|webp)(\?|$) /404error.php [L,NC]

R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>

PS论坛后台 -> 搜索引擎优化 -> 伪静态? -> [v] 是 -> 确认

image.png

回论坛前台,网址已经不包括index.php了

 

如果不喜欢网址后面的标题太长

https://你的网址.com/topic/2-新主题标题/

改法为
论坛后台 -> 系统 -> 高级配置 -> 友好网址 ->

看到友好网址后面连接 -?? 问号的 -> 编辑 ->

image.png

友好网址 -> 只删掉 -{?}

然后按确认,千万别改错了
 

image.png

 

 

image.png

 

这种 -?? 要修改的地方很多,并且插件安装越多,也就修改越多

以后再安装什么插件,一样要来此处修改它,别忘了
 

修改好后的友好网址

image.png
 

清除缓存

论坛后台 -> 系统 -> 支持 -> 清除缓存

  

回到论坛前台,原本的情况

https://你的网址.com/topic/2-新主题标题/

已更改为

https://你的网址.com/topic/2/

0篇意见

推荐意见

没有意见。

24 小时在线成员 6